数据可视化平台搭建如何实现数据可视化监控?
随着大数据时代的到来,数据可视化成为企业管理和决策的重要工具。数据可视化平台搭建是实现数据可视化监控的关键步骤。本文将详细介绍数据可视化平台搭建的过程,以及如何实现数据可视化监控。
一、数据可视化平台搭建
- 需求分析
在进行数据可视化平台搭建之前,首先要明确平台的需求。这包括数据来源、数据类型、可视化需求等。需求分析是搭建数据可视化平台的基础,只有明确了需求,才能确保平台的实用性。
- 技术选型
根据需求分析,选择合适的技术栈。目前,市面上主流的数据可视化技术有:ECharts、Highcharts、D3.js等。在选择技术时,要考虑以下因素:
- 易用性:选择易于上手和使用的可视化库。
- 性能:选择性能较好的可视化库,以保证平台的高效运行。
- 扩展性:选择具有良好扩展性的可视化库,以适应未来需求的变化。
- 数据接入
数据接入是数据可视化平台搭建的关键环节。常用的数据接入方式有:
- 数据库接入:通过数据库连接,直接从数据库中读取数据。
- API接入:通过调用第三方API接口,获取数据。
- 文件导入:将数据存储在本地文件中,通过文件导入功能读取数据。
- 数据处理
在数据接入后,需要对数据进行清洗、转换和预处理。数据处理主要包括以下步骤:
- 数据清洗:去除无效、错误和重复的数据。
- 数据转换:将数据转换为可视化所需的格式。
- 数据预处理:对数据进行归一化、标准化等操作,提高数据质量。
- 可视化设计
根据需求,设计可视化图表。可视化设计主要包括以下方面:
- 图表类型:选择合适的图表类型,如柱状图、折线图、饼图等。
- 颜色搭配:合理搭配颜色,使图表更具视觉冲击力。
- 交互设计:设计交互功能,如缩放、拖拽、筛选等,提高用户体验。
- 平台部署
将搭建好的数据可视化平台部署到服务器上,供用户访问和使用。
二、数据可视化监控实现
- 实时监控
通过数据可视化平台,可以实时监控数据变化。例如,企业可以通过实时监控销售数据,了解产品销售情况,及时调整销售策略。
- 趋势分析
通过数据可视化平台,可以对历史数据进行趋势分析。例如,企业可以通过分析销售数据趋势,预测未来销售情况,为决策提供依据。
- 异常检测
通过数据可视化平台,可以及时发现数据异常。例如,企业可以通过监控生产数据,发现设备故障,及时进行维修。
- 数据导出
数据可视化平台可以将数据导出为Excel、CSV等格式,方便用户进行进一步分析。
案例分析:
某电商企业通过搭建数据可视化平台,实现了以下功能:
- 实时监控销售数据:企业可以实时了解销售情况,及时调整促销策略。
- 分析用户行为:通过分析用户行为数据,企业可以优化产品和服务,提高用户满意度。
- 预测销售趋势:通过分析历史销售数据,企业可以预测未来销售情况,提前做好准备。
总结:
数据可视化平台搭建是实现数据可视化监控的关键步骤。通过搭建数据可视化平台,企业可以实时监控数据变化,分析数据趋势,发现数据异常,为决策提供有力支持。在搭建数据可视化平台时,要充分考虑需求、技术选型、数据接入、数据处理、可视化设计和平台部署等方面,确保平台的实用性和可靠性。
猜你喜欢:分布式追踪